What are the themes often explored in Vietnam fiction stories?
Another theme is the clash of cultures. Vietnam has a long history of being influenced by different foreign cultures, like the French and the Americans. Fiction stories often explore how the Vietnamese people adapt, resist, or are changed by these foreign influences. 'The Quiet American' is a good example of this, showing how the Western ideas and actions impact the local people in Vietnam.

Famous Authors in Vietnam Fiction
Bao Ninh is quite famous. His work 'The Sorrow of War' has been widely read both in Vietnam and internationally. It gives a deep look into the psychological trauma of war for the soldiers.

Can you recommend some good Vietnam fiction stories?
Another great one is 'Paradise of the Blind' by Dương Thu Hương. It delves into the complex family relationships and the social changes in Vietnam. The story follows a young woman as she discovers the secrets of her family's past and the hardships they endured. It also shows how different generations in Vietnam have different values and outlooks on life.

What are some notable Vietnam War short stories in fiction?
One well - known Vietnam War short story is 'The Things They Carried' by Tim O'Brien. It delves into the physical and emotional burdens of the soldiers. Another is 'How to Tell a True War Story' also by O'Brien, which challenges the very idea of what makes a war story 'true' and shows the complex and often surreal nature of the Vietnam War experience.

Who are the famous authors of Vietnam War fiction short stories?
Tim O'Brien is a very famous author. His works like 'The Things They Carried' are widely read and studied. He uses his own experiences in Vietnam to create stories that are both deeply personal and universal in their exploration of war.

Must - read Vietnam Fiction Books
Another is 'The Quiet American' by Graham Greene. This book delves into the complex political and human situation in Vietnam during the early days of American involvement. It shows the different motives and naivete of the Westerners in the region. It's a thought - provoking read that explores themes of colonialism, love, and war.
